IRS Issues Foreign Tax Credit Guidance Over Puerto Rico Issue

Sept. 16, 2022, 8:52 PM UTC

The IRS issued guidance Friday aimed at reassuring taxpayers that they’ll still be eligible to use US foreign tax credits in certain situations in Puerto Rico when some had feared they might not be able to.

Under a notice issued Friday (Notice 2022-42), the IRS said that if taxpayers amend their long-term Puerto Rican tax agreements under the terms of a new law there, any excess payments they make to Puerto Rico as a result won’t be considered “noncompulsory payments,” which would make them ineligible for the foreign tax credit.
